Output 595e8e7c615f126d33106012ff0c7b81b74bc352e5460aa8e7766532ee36ece5:1

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9848879a341989b41da1fab36341e8d69bc93a29 OP_EQUAL
address
3FaDX9s96ScBRYXVGBFQrqSZqFJPCQqJPb
transaction
595e8e7c615f126d33106012ff0c7b81b74bc352e5460aa8e7766532ee36ece5
confirmations
377266
spent
true